Skip to content

yunho0130/start-RL

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

70 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

start-RL

《Do it 강화 학습 입문(Beginning Reinforcement Learning)》 소스 코드 저장소

Yes24

실습 소스 코드

01장 강화 학습이란?

03장 알파고 도전을 위한 첫 걸음

  • OpenAI Gym Retro 환경에서 강화 학습 모델 훈련시키기

    • Airstriker-Genesis 게임을 플레이하는 강화 학습 모델

    OpenAI gym-retro 소스 코드 살펴보기

  • UnityML 환경에서 강화 학습 모델 훈련시키기

    • 머리 위에 올려진 공을 떨어뜨리지 않는 3Dball 환경

    • 이족보행을 학습시켜 목적지까지 이동시키는 Walker 환경

    • 여러 에이전트간 상호작용이 필요한 Soccer 환경

    UnityML 소스 코드 살펴보기

04장 딥레이서로 구현하는 자율 주행

05장 영화 <아이언맨>의 자비스 만들기

  • Google Colab 통한 실습
    아래의 Jupyter Notebook 파일은 Google Colab과 연결되도록 만들어 두었습니다. 이를 통해 05장의 주요 강화 학습 모델 학습 코드를 간편하게 실행해 보세요.

  • OpenAI GPT-2로 알아보는 자연어 처리

  • OpenAI GPT-3와 강화 학습의 미래

06장 분산 강화 학습 공부하기

  • MS Azure 무료 체험으로 할 수 있는 분산 강화 학습 실습
    • 윈도우 원격 데스크톱 접속 환경 구성하기
    • Ray 아키텍쳐 및 RLlib 설치 하기
    • 분산환경에서 카트폴 실행 하기

분산 강화 학습 실습 명령어 및 예제 코드 살펴보기

07장 강화 학습으로 만드는 신경망 구조

  • NNI ENAS를 활용한 NAS 실습 보기
    • 매크로 탐색 공간을 활용한 ENAS
    • 마이크로 탐색 공간을 활용한 ENAS
    • ENAS에서 생성된 신경망 구조를 활용한 재학습

NNI ENAS 실습 명령어 및 예제 코드 살펴보기

인용 Citation

본 레파지토리나 《Do it! 강화 학습 입문》의 내용을 인용하실 때에는 아래의 인용 정보를 사용하시면 편리합니다.

@book{Do-it-Reinforcement-Learning,
  title={Do it! 강화 학습 입문},
  author={조규남, 맹윤호, 임지순},
  isbn={9791163032526},
  url={http://www.yes24.com/Product/Goods/101924618},
  year={2021},
  publisher={이지스퍼블리싱}
}

About

<Do it 강화학습 입문(Getting Started with Deep Reinforcement Learning)> 소스코드 저장소

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published